riding lawn Archive
Renault Duster Suv Launched In India At Rs 7.19 Lakhs

The 2011 new car model year is upon us and with implies comes the onslaught of cars were being totally redesigned or all-new for the annual changeover. This year there were so many important introductions that barefoot running is hard as quickly as possible track of all of them. Mercedes-Benz and Volkswagen already been producing
Category: luxury suv